分布式高性能备份系统:mysql、ElasticSearch统一存储解决方案

0 下载量 153 浏览量 更新于2024-09-29 收藏 5.8MB ZIP 举报
资源摘要信息:"一款分布式高性能的备份系统,支持mysql、ElasticSearch备份,多集群任务统一,数据集中存储.zip" 从提供的文件信息中,我们可以提炼出以下几个重要的知识点,以供IT专业人士深入理解和应用。 1. 分布式备份系统概念:首先,分布式备份系统是一种数据存储架构,它将数据备份和恢复的工作分布在不同的物理或虚拟节点上,实现数据的高可用性和灾难恢复能力。该备份系统支持MySQL和ElasticSearch,说明它是针对不同数据存储需求设计的。 2. MySQL备份技术:MySQL是一个流行的开源关系型数据库管理系统(RDBMS),广泛应用于网站、应用程序和服务中。分布式备份系统能够对MySQL数据库进行备份,意味着它能够支持定时或实时地捕获和保存数据库的状态,以便在数据丢失或损坏的情况下能够恢复到某个时间点。 3. Elasticsearch备份策略:ElasticSearch是一个基于Apache Lucene构建的开源、分布式、RESTful搜索引擎。它通常用于全文搜索和日志分析等场景。该备份系统对ElasticSearch的备份支持表明它能够在分布式环境中进行数据快照和索引备份,保证数据的完整性和搜索性能。 4. 多集群任务管理:在分布式系统中,多集群任务管理是指系统能够协调和管理分布在不同集群中的任务。这意味着备份系统能够统一调度和处理跨多个集群的任务,实现高效的任务分配和执行。 5. 数据集中存储:数据集中存储意味着所有备份数据将被集中保存在一个或多个中心位置,便于管理和访问。对于备份系统来说,集中存储可以提高备份效率、节省存储空间,并简化备份数据的恢复流程。 6. 开源学习和技术交流:本资源明确指出可用于开源学习和技术交流,这表明它鼓励IT社区成员在遵守开源许可的条件下使用和分享项目知识,促进技术进步和创新。 7. 开发工具和学习资料的支持:资源提供者表示愿意提供相关的开发工具和学习资料的帮助,这对于希望进一步提高开发技能和项目实施能力的个人来说是一大福音。 8. 适用场景:提供的资源适合多种应用场景,包括但不限于项目开发、学习练手、课程设计和学科竞赛等,这说明备份系统具有广泛的应用范围和灵活性。 9. 商用限制:需要注意的是,本资源仅供开源学习和技术交流使用,不得用于商业目的,使用者需要承担相关的后果。 10. 版权问题:资源中部分字体和插图可能来源于网络,若存在侵权问题,使用者需要联系资源提供者处理,资源提供者不承担由此产生的法律责任。 最后,文件名称“DSmysqlffv1”可能代表该备份系统的某个版本号或者是一个特定的标识符,而具体的源码、工程文件和说明文件应包含在压缩包内,以便用户能够进行复刻和进一步的开发和学习。